There was a flutter of excitement in the Junior Section on Wednesday morning as we welcomed some very special guests: Ernie the Owl and the dedicated team from Leeds Hospitals Charity.
The visit provided a wonderful opportunity for our pupils to learn more about the charity’s vital mission. Ernie and the team shared moving insights into how their work supports patients and families during their time in hospital, ensuring that even the most difficult days are made a little brighter with care and comfort.
The highlight of the morning was a truly special announcement. Through various school events and initiatives, our incredible school community has raised over £5,000 for the charity! However, the celebration didn’t stop there. We were absolutely blown away to highlight the individual efforts of Isobel, who has raised over £3,000 through her own incredible dedication and hard work. Together, this staggering total of over £8,000 will go a long way in supporting local families.
To cap off the morning, Ernie even managed to ‘fly’ into several classrooms, providing a delightful surprise for both teachers and pupils mid-lesson. We would like to extend our heartfelt thanks to the Leeds Hospitals Charity team for visiting us and, more importantly, for the life-changing work they do every day in our region.
